Transaction 52a13723f4b2454139e40b3fafc161a5f31953f2a9233c49eb45280d7fd3be31

block
30cc0a3a73ec5512d4f88d4c9b315941d77c78d0820c011a3256a9f9e26da138

1 Input

23 Outputs